Transaction 5878fb66b9baf14a4284e9eba915a41d3c73429a3ea114db87ab8bc002a2a380

1 Input
2 Outputs
  • 5878fb66b9baf14a4284e9eba915a41d3c73429a3ea114db87ab8bc002a2a380:0
  • value  3932896928
    address  2Mx3r3ar3dbPtKPcEnZSo1FthzXGAqqU18h
  • 5878fb66b9baf14a4284e9eba915a41d3c73429a3ea114db87ab8bc002a2a380:1
  • value  1132995
    address  2NGEERmkQ32aznhrRWw6q8o6SfKVEdHVikY